About black walnut

Black walnut, Juglans nigra, is a large, long-lived deciduous tree valued for its dark, dense timber and edible nuts. It develops a broad, rounded crown and strong central trunk, creating deep, shifting shade as it matures.

This species is native to eastern North America, where it grows in rich forests and along river valleys. It produces a chemical called juglone in its roots, leaves, and husks, which can inhibit the growth of many nearby plants and makes site selection important when you care for black walnut.

Black walnut prefers full sun, deep, well-drained soil, and consistent moisture in its early years, and it generally suits larger gardens or rural properties rather than small urban yards.

How to Care for the black walnut

Juglans nigra develops best with strong outdoor light from an open, unshaded position.

  • Provide full sun for 6–8+ hours per day; trees in partial shade grow slower and produce fewer nuts.
  • Allow light afternoon shade in hotter regions to reduce leaf scorch, especially on young black walnut trees.
  • Ensure the canopy stays unshaded by nearby trees or buildings in spring and summer, as prolonged low light leads to sparse branching and weak growth.

Juglans nigra prefers consistent soil moisture but dislikes prolonged saturation.

  • In the first 2–3 years, water when the top 5–8 cm of soil feels dry, then soak the root zone deeply rather than giving frequent shallow waterings.
  • Mature trees usually rely on rainfall; supplement only during extended dry periods when leaves start to dull or wilt slightly.
  • Plant in well-drained loam or sandy loam; persistent puddling, yellowing leaves, and dieback indicate overwatering or poor drainage.

This species is adapted to temperate climates with cold winters and warm summers.

  • Active growth is strongest around 70–85°F (21–29°C), with long, warm summers supporting nut development.
  • Dormant trees tolerate winter lows near -20°F (-29°C), but young saplings benefit from protection from harsh wind and freeze–thaw cycles.
  • Mature trees handle short heat waves up to about 95°F (35°C) if soil moisture is adequate, though extreme, prolonged heat can stress foliage and reduce yield.

Humidity is not a critical factor for Juglans nigra, which thrives in typical outdoor conditions.

Juglans nigra performs best in deep, fertile, well-structured soil that remains moist but never waterlogged.

  • Use a loamy soil rich in organic matter, with a mix of garden loam, compost, and some coarse sand for structure.
  • Aim for slightly acidic to neutral pH, around 6.0–7.5, avoiding strongly alkaline or saline sites.
  • Improve aeration and drainage on heavier soils by incorporating 20–30% coarse sand or fine gravel into the top 30–40 cm.
  • Avoid compacted, shallow, or periodically flooded soils, which restrict root development and increase root disease risk.

This species is generally unsuitable for long-term container growing due to its large, deep root system and mature size.

Juglans nigra usually grows well in average soil, but targeted feeding can support nut production and early growth.

  • Use a balanced slow-release fertilizer (for example 10-10-10) or well-rotted compost in early spring, worked lightly into the root zone outside the trunk flare.
  • Apply at most once per year for established trees; young trees on poor soils may benefit from 2 light applications in spring and early summer.
  • Reduce or stop feeding from late summer onward so new growth hardens before frost, and never fertilize during winter dormancy.
  • Apply at half the label rate near the tree and avoid placing fertilizer directly against the trunk to limit root burn and salt stress.

Pruning Juglans nigra focuses on structure and safety rather than frequent shaping.

  • Time main pruning for late winter to very early spring before budbreak to limit bleeding and disease entry.
  • Remove dead, damaged, rubbing, or crossing branches first, then thin crowded interior branches to improve light and air flow.
  • Use sharp bypass pruners or a clean pruning saw and make cuts just outside the branch collar to support proper wound closure.
  • Limit large cuts on mature trees and rely on structural pruning in the first 5–10 years to set strong branch angles and clear trunk height.

Black walnut develops a deep taproot early, so long-term container culture is impractical and transplanting must be timed carefully.

  • Look for roots circling the pot drainage holes or very slow growth as signs a young tree must move out of its container.
  • Transplant in late fall after leaf drop or very early spring while dormant, which reduces transplant shock and water stress.
  • Shift seedlings from small pots to deep containers only once, then transplant to a permanent site within 1–3 years before the taproot becomes difficult to move.
  • Dig a wide planting hole, keep roots moist, avoid bending or cutting the taproot when possible, then water thoroughly and mulch 5–8 cm deep, keeping mulch off the trunk.

Juglans nigra is propagated mainly from seed, which demands patience and specific conditions for good germination.

  • Collect mature nuts in fall, remove husks, and discard any that float in water as they are often not viable.
  • Provide cold stratification at 34–41°F for about 90–120 days in moist, well-drained medium to break seed dormancy.
  • Sow stratified nuts 5–8 cm deep in deep pots or outdoor nursery beds in spring, protecting from rodents with hardware cloth or similar barriers.
  • Maintain evenly moist but not waterlogged soil and full sun; thin or transplant seedlings while young to avoid severe taproot disturbance.

Juglans nigra is fully cold hardy across most temperate regions and generally needs minimal winter care once established.

  • Young trees benefit from 5–8 cm of organic mulch over the root zone to limit freeze–thaw cycles and conserve moisture.
  • Keep mulch a few cm away from the trunk to reduce bark rot and rodent damage during winter.
  • For container-grown seedlings in cold climates, move pots into an unheated but sheltered space to avoid root freezing in thin-walled containers.

Care Tips

Plan root clearance

Before planting, map a 50–70 ft radius where roots and shade will expand, and keep buildings, septic lines, and paved areas out of this zone to prevent long‑term structural conflicts.

Manage juglone impact

Create a mulch buffer ring 1–2 ft wide and avoid planting susceptible species such as tomatoes, potatoes, apples, and many ornamentals within 40–60 ft to reduce problems from juglone, the natural toxin produced by roots and fallen debris.

Use sacrificial branches

On windy or exposed sites, leave some lower temporary branches during the first 5–10 years so they act as wind buffers, then remove them gradually to develop a straight, clear trunk.

Prioritize central leader

Each late winter, select the strongest vertical stem as the main leader and remove competing upright branches with clean cuts to build a single, stable trunk that supports future timber-quality growth.

Time pruning carefully

Schedule any structural or corrective pruning for mid to late winter when the tree is fully dormant, since cutting in late spring or midsummer can lead to heavy sap bleed and increased stress when growing black walnut.

Common Pests and Diseases

Walnut anthracnose

This disease causes dark circular leaf spots that often coalesce, leading to yellowing and early leaf drop, especially in wet seasons.

Solution

Prune and remove fallen infected leaves and twigs to reduce inoculum, and ensure good spacing and airflow around trees. In high-value plantings, apply a copper-based fungicide or labeled broad-spectrum fungicide at bud break and repeat during wet periods according to label directions.

Thousand cankers disease

This disease results from a fungal infection spread by walnut twig beetles and causes numerous small cankers under the bark, progressive branch dieback, and eventual tree decline.

Solution

Monitor for canopy thinning and dieback, avoid moving potentially infested firewood or logs, and promptly remove and destroy severely affected branches or trees to slow spread. Support tree vigor with proper watering during drought and avoid trunk injury; in affected regions, consult local forestry or extension services for updated management recommendations for caring for black walnut.

Walnut husk fly

These insects lay eggs in developing husks; larvae feed inside, causing black, mushy husks and stained or damaged shells, which lowers nut quality.

Solution

Collect and destroy fallen infested nuts and husks to break the life cycle, and use yellow sticky traps baited with ammonia or other attractants to monitor adult flights. In nut production settings, apply appropriately labeled insecticides when monitoring shows adult activity and before peak egg-laying, following regional timing guides.

Walnut caterpillars

These insects are defoliating caterpillars that feed in groups, stripping leaves from branches and sometimes leaving entire sections of the canopy bare.

Solution

Inspect trees in late spring and summer for clusters of caterpillars and frass, then prune off and destroy infested branches where practical. On larger trees or heavier infestations, use Bacillus thuringiensis (Bt) or other targeted insecticides when caterpillars are small, and encourage natural predators by minimizing broad-spectrum insecticide use.

Walnut leaf blotch

This disease creates irregular brown to reddish lesions on leaves and sometimes on young shoots, leading to premature leaf drop and reduced vigor over time.

Solution

Rake and dispose of fallen leaves and prune out heavily spotted shoots to reduce fungal spores. Improve air circulation by thinning crowded branches, and in orchards or high-value trees, consider a preventive fungicide program beginning at leaf emergence if the disease has been severe in previous years.

Interesting Facts

Powerful allelopathic chemistry

Black walnut roots, leaves, and husks release a compound called juglone, which can inhibit or kill many nearby plant species, especially within the root zone where concentrations are highest.

Deep taproot strategy

Young black walnut trees develop a strong, deep taproot early in life, which anchors the tree and allows access to deeper soil moisture, making transplanted specimens difficult to move once established.

High-value hardwood timber

The dark, dense heartwood of black walnut is prized for fine furniture, veneer, and gunstocks, and long-term timber plantings of this species are often managed as high-value forestry investments.
